Abstract
We present Magnet Mail (MM), a visualization system to retrieve information from email archives via a zoomable interface. MM allows users to infer relationships among their email documents based on searching keywords. The prototype interacts with a mass-market email system and uses a magnet metaphor to simulate user interaction with emails. The graphical implementation relies mostly on the Piccolo toolkit.
